Ranked #40 in popularity, chemical engineering is one of the most sought-after bachelor's degree programs in the nation. So, there are lots of possibilities to explore when you're trying to determine where you want to get your degree.

In 2024, College Factual analyzed 3 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Best Chemical Engineering Bachelor's Degree Schools in New Mexico ranking. Combined, these schools handed out 106 bachelor's degrees in chemical engineering to qualified students.

Overall Quality Is a Must

The overall quality of a bachelor's degree school is important to ensure a quality education, not just how well they do in a particular major. To take this into account we include a school's overall Best Colleges ranking which itself looks at a combination of different factors like degree completion, educational resources, student body caliber and post-graduation earnings for the school as a whole.

Top New Mexico Schools for a Bachelor's in Chem Eng

1
Master's Degree Highest Degree Type
23 Annual Graduates

New Mexico State University - Main Campus is one of the best schools in the United States for getting a bachelor's degree in chemical engineering. Located in the medium-sized suburb of Las Cruces, NMSU Main Campus is a public university with a fairly large student population.More information about a bachelor’s in chemical engineering from New Mexico State University - Main Campus

2
Master's Degree Highest Degree Type
64 Annual Graduates

Every student pursuing a degree in a bachelor's degree in chemical engineering has to check out University of New Mexico - Main Campus. Located in the city of Albuquerque, UNM is a public university with a very large student population.More information about a bachelor’s in chemical engineering from University of New Mexico - Main Campus

3
19 Annual Graduates

It's hard to beat New Mexico Institute of Mining and Technology if you want to pursue a bachelor's degree in chemical engineering. New Mexico Tech is a small public school located in the remote town of Socorro.More information about a bachelor’s in chemical engineering from New Mexico Institute of Mining and Technology
